Abstract (EN)

The aim of present study is to determine phenolic compounds, antioxidant capacity, fatty acids compositions, lipite-soluble vitamins and sterol contents five speices( S. russellii Bentham; S. multicaulis Vahl; S. palaestina Bentham; S. microstegia Boiss. & Bal. ve S. virgata Jacq.) of Salvia grown in Elazığ. Chromatographic analysis of flavonoid and phenolic acids of studied Salvia species done by using PREVAIL C18 reversed-phase colon (15x4.6mm, 5µm, USA). Also, antioxidant capacity was determined DPPH radical scavenging method. In the study, analysis of fatty acid compositions of species were done by using SHIMADZU GC 17 Ver. 3 and lipite-soluble vitamine and sterol contents were determined by using HPLC [Supelcosil TM LC18 (250×4.6 mm, 5 μm, Sigma, USA)]. It was found that five Salvia species have high rutin content (371,6±4,1-857,1±4,6 μg/g). Also, studied Salvia species except for S. virgata have high catechin content (208,2±3,2-1207,8±5,2 μg/g). Furthermore, vanilic acid (101,4±1,5-677,4±1,8 μg/g) and rosmarinic acid (632,6±2,27-2528,6±4,7 μg/g) contents of Salvia species were found high. It was seen that DPPH radical scavenging results of study are between % 38,5±0,6 and % 61,1±0,68. On the other hand, palmitic acid (C16:0) was found as major saturated fatty acid while palmitoelic acid (C16:1), oleic acid (C18:1 n9), linoleic acid (C18:2 n6) and α-linoleic acid (C18:3 n3) were major unsaturated fatty acids. Additionally, species have low lipite-soluble vitamin content. But Salvia species high ergosterol and β-sitosterol content.
